What are the most common Dodge repair issues seen in Modest Town due to local driving conditions?

Given the rural roads and potential for harsh winters on the Eastern Shore, we commonly see suspension wear, brake issues from stop-and-go country driving, and electrical problems related to moisture and corrosion. Dodge trucks and SUVs also frequently need attention for 4x4 system maintenance to handle unpaved or sandy back roads.

When should I seek service for my Dodge's check engine light around Modest Town?

Seek service promptly, as a check engine light can indicate issues that affect fuel efficiency or emissions, important for passing Virginia state inspection. Delaying can lead to more costly repairs, especially if it's related to the catalytic converter or oxygen sensors, which are critical for your vehicle's performance on long, rural commutes.

What local considerations should Dodge Ram truck owners in Modest Town keep in mind for maintenance?

If you use your Ram for hauling boats, trailers, or agricultural equipment, adhere strictly to severe service schedule intervals for transmission and differential fluid changes. Also, frequently inspect the undercarriage for rust due to proximity to saltwater and coastal humidity, and consider undercoating for added protection.
